Latest Patents
Among his latest patents, the "Bodyrest" apparatus stands out as a personal support device designed to enhance user comfort during forward-leaning positions. This apparatus features a frame that supports the forehead, accommodates the user's face, and offers adjustable height settings through a stand equipped with a chest support.
Another notable invention is the "Mobile Device Stand," which is a versatile, collapsible apparatus designed to hold mobile devices securely. It includes a mobile device support body, a base, and a stand that allows for multiple configurations, adjusting to different sizes and orientations of devices. This adaptability ensures that users can enjoy their devices at various heights and angles.
